Welcome to our Ingredient Glossary 

achellia millefolium (yarrow) - a perennial herb used for centuries for its ability to soothe irritated or damaged skin and reduce inflammation / redness. It is one of the herbs infused into The Balm.

aloe barbadensis (aloe vera) leaf juice - is well respected for its application as a moisturizing agent and skin soother. It contains vitamin B complex, folic acid, vitamin C and carotene. It is a hero ingredient in many of our products such as mists, toners, lotions and cleansers.

althaea officials (marshmallow) root - the mucilage in the marshmallow plant contains antioxidants which research suggests forms a protective coating around mucous membranes to soothe redness, reduce inflammation and help retain moisture in skin. We infuse it into Baby Balm and The Balm.

aniba rosaedora (rose) petals and buds - aside from the lovely aroma of dried rose petals they contain vitamins and antioxidants. Find them in our Face Steams and Bath Teas to soothe and soften skin.

anthemis nobilis (chamomile) - you will find different forms of chamomile in many of our formulations: botanical extract, essential oil, flower water and dried flowers. Chamomile contains powerful antioxidants which help the skin to regenerate, tighten pores and reduce the appearance of fine lines and wrinkles.

aqua (water) - we use distilled water in our hydrous (containing water) products.

arctium lappa L. (burdock) root extract - this herb contains Vitamins B complex and E. In addition, it boasts trace minerals of potassium, phosphorous, chromium, cobalt, iron, magnesium, silicon, zinc and sodium. We add it to our French Pink Clay mask to deep clean the pores, and purify the surface of the skin.

argania spinosa (argan) cold pressed virgin oil - rich in vitamin E, carotenes, antioxidants and essential fatty acids,  it is a prized ingredient in formulas to reduce the appearance of fine lines and wrinkless, such as our Argan Rosehip Face Serum. 

avena sativa (oat) flour - also known as colloidal oatmeal, and found in our Bath Teas to moisturize and soothe dry and problem skin. This colloidal oatmeal is GMO-free and consists of key components such as beta glucan and avenanthramides, which act as a natural, deep penetrating moisturizer to reduce the itching caused by dry skin.

bakuchiol -  extracted from the seeds of the psoralea corylifolia plant, bakuchiol is a potent antioxidant and has clinically demonstrated the ability to reduce hyperpigmentation and wrinkles as efficiently as retinol. It has a pronounced soothing effect on skin and benefits all skin types.

beeswax - hydrates, conditions, soothes, and calms the skin. It exfoliates, repairs damage, promotes the skin’s regeneration, diminishes the appearance of the signs of aging, soothes itchiness and irritation, and creates a hydrating, long-lasting protective barrier against environmental pollutants.

benzyl alcohol - derived from natural sources, this non-drying alcohol serves as a preservative in cosmetics products, and is considered one of the least-sensitizing preservatives in use.

benzyl alcohol & salicylic acid & glycerin & sorbic acid - a preservative system with the Trade name Eco/ Geogard™ ECT, that meets Ecocert and COSMOS standards. This is a broad-spectrum preservative which contains four different components: benzyl alcohol, salicylic acid, glycerin and sorbic acid. These molecules are all found in nature in plants such as pine resin, rowan berries and willow bark. It is a non-paraben, non-formaldehyde, nonisothiazolone-based preservative system.

boswellia carterii (frankincense) oil - an essential oil that has a warm and spicy, smokey and woody aroma, calms and soothes the complexion and has the ability to strengthen skin and improve its tone and elasticity.  

bursera graveolens (palo santo) wood oil - an essential oil with a fresh, intense woody aroma with a slight hint of citrus. This healing oil infuses your skin with potent levels of D-Limonene and Monoterpenes to provide deeply restorative and protective benefits at a cellular level to support a calm, balanced complexion.

butrospermum parkii (shea) butter - shea butter is fat extracted from the nuts of the shea tree.This skincare superhero contains fatty acids and vitamins A and E. It relieves dry skin, eases irritation, seals in moisture and combined with its easy-to-spread consistency, is a great product for smoothing, soothing, and conditioning your skin.

cacao powder - the raw version of cocoa and less processed. We use it in lip balm to provide colour and flavour. 

calendula officinalis (marigold) flower - another super hero ingredient. Properties which include anti-inflammatory, anti-bacterial, anti-fungal, antioxidant, anti-microbial and collagen repair make it an important ingredient in skincare and wound healing. Calendula flowers also demonstrate a strong bioadhesive or mucilaginous effect, which may not only help to decrease local inflammation by shielding tissues from irritants, but also facilitate tissue hydration. cananga odorata (ylang ylang) flower oil - an essential oil with a sweet, exotic, floral scent that is both purifying and balancing. Potent anti-bacterial properties make it a healing powerhouse, boosting the regenerative process of the epidermis. It also works wonders to help regulate your sebum production.

cannibis sativa (hemp) seed oil - unrefined hempseed oil, which has been left in its virgin state after pressing, and is completely natural. This oil is high in Omega fatty acids and proteins, and reduces visible signs of aging while replenishing and protecting the skin’s moisture barrier and improving the texture of skin.

capryl glucoside - a mild, solubilizing non-ionic surfactant that is obtained from renewable raw materials: fatty alcohols and glucose from vegetable origin. An ultra-gentle, natural, cleansing, solubilizing foaming agent containing 60% active matter that is ECOCERT Certified, preservative free and free of impurities.

caprylic/capric triglycerides (coconut oil) - this MCT 60/40 Fractionated Coconut Oil is produced 100% from coconuts. It penetrates the skin readily, contains healthy fatty acids, is naturally rich in antioxidants and antibacterial properties and provides lightweight moisture and conditioning to the skin.

cedrus atlantica (cedarwood) bark oil - an essential oil with a sweet woodsy scent, steam distilled from the bark of the Cedar tree. It helps regulate sebum production, soothe irritation, inflammation, redness, and itchiness, as well as dryness that leads to cracking, peeling, or blistering. 

cetearyl alcohol (and) sodium cetearyl sulfate - emulsifying wax N - makes an ionic self-emulsifying base specifically for oil and water cosmetic lotions and creams. It is PEG-free and gluten-free, and is approved by Ecocert for use as an ingredient in natural and organic cosmetics.

cinnamomum camphora (camphor) bark oil - an essential oil with an intense clean, bright and piercing scent. Used topically, the cooling effects of soothe inflammation, redness, insect bites, itching, irritation, rashes, acne, sprains, and muscular aches and pains.

cinnamomum camphora (howood) oil - a sweet woody slightly floral essential oil with a peaceful, calming aroma.

cinnamomun zeylanicum (cinnamon) bark oil - this essential oil has a warm spicy scent characteristic of cinnamon. Used in aromatherapy,  it helps to relax, manage stressful feelings and enhance mood. Benefits also include moisturizing and astringent properties to help cleanse and tone the skin and hair.

citric acid - used in small amounts to adjust the pH of products. Derived from citrus fruits, it keeps formulas from being too alkaline.

citrus aurantifolia (lime) peel oil - the scent of this essential oil gives a fresh, energizing feeling due to its sharp, sweet and fruity fragrance. Useful during the cold and flu seasons can uplift the mood, purify the air and comes with benefits for the skin and hair.

citrus aurantium amara (flower oil) - neroli essential oil is a hydration powerhouse, with an incredible ability to soften and replenish skin and lock in moisture. Safe for sensitive skin, and is known for it's beautiful heady scent.

citrus aurantium amara (bitter orange) leaf/twig oil - petitgrain essential oil has a bright refreshing energizing aroma and is balancing and toning to the skin. 

citrus aurantium bergamia (bergamot) peel oil - an essential oil with a fruity and sweet citrus aroma, along with a warm spicy floral quality. It works to stimulate skin cell renewal and balance oils in skin for an even and toned complexion.

citrus limon (lemon) peel oil - is the fresh sweet citrus essence, with a strong bright lemony scent, obtained from lemon peels. It's benefits include cleansing and purifying properties as well as a brightening influence on skin and hair.

citrus paradisi (grapefruit) peel oil - has a fresh sweet citrus smell characteristic of the fruit. Popular for use in aromatherapy for it's uplifting scent and skincare products to help maintain smooth looking skin and balance oil production.

citrus sinensis (orange) peel oil - has a fresh fruity uplifting aroma and has been associated with mood-boosting, antibacterial, antifungal, decongestant, and immune system benefits.

coco betaine - coco betaine is made from fatty acids derived from coconut oil. It has no propyl group and is also missing the ‘amido’ functional group as compared to its closely related surfactant cocamidopropyl betaine. It is a very mild co-surfactant that also has good conditioning properties.

cocos nucifera fruit powder - is the powder obtained from the dried ground fruit of the coconut ( also known as coconut milk powder). It is a natural emollient, leaves skin soft, supple and hydrated, and provides nutrients to the skin as it is rich in vitamins, minerals, fiber and amino acids.

coffee grounds - we use ground coffee in our coffee scrub to gently exfoliate dead surface skin cells, stimulate circulation and leave skin feeling soft and smooth.

cucumis sativus (cucumber peel) botanical extract - makes a wonderful addition to skin-care products for its cooling and skin-tightening properties. It is rich in vitamins and a powerful antioxidant. It can revitalize and refresh tired stressed skin leaving it feeling and looking soft, smooth and radiant. 

cymbopogon flexuosus (lemongrass) herb oil - while studies support lemongrass oil as a bug repellent, it does require frequent reapplication. To repel mosquitoes most effectively, reapply lotions and sprays every 30–60 minutes. It is also known to be beneficial for creating a feeling of being refreshed and renewed, uplifting negative moods and relieving anxiety.

cymbopogon martini (palmarosa) oil - has a sweet, floral fragrance. It is said to stimulate the skin's natural secretion of sebum making it beneficial for dry skin.

cymbopogon nardus ( citronella) oil - has a well-rounded lemony scent, though it is much softer and has subtle wood tones. It can be used as a Mosquito Repellent, and to stimulate, refresh and deodorize sweaty and tired feet.

daucus carota sativa (carrot) seed oil - is extracted from the seeds of the wild carrot plant known as daucus carota. Cold-pressed from carrot seeds, it is used in skincare products for its ability to reduce the appearance of fine lines and wrinkles. Find it in our Revitalize Eye Serum to gently moisturize the delicate under eye area. 

decyl glucoside - is a mild, natural, vegan, plant-derived, biodegradable, non-toxic, and sustainable cleansing agent suitable for delicate skin. It belongs to the alkyl glucosides family of surfactants and is commonly used as a non-toxic and eco-friendly alternative to conventional sulfates (like sodium laurel sulfate and sodium laureth sulfate).

elettaria cardamomum (cardamom) seed oil - an essential oil with a strong, sweet, spicy and almost balsamic fragrance, with soothing and balancing benefits.

ethanol - a clear colourless alcohol that is an ingredient in our hand spray, used to sanitize by killing a range of bacteria and viruses.

eucalyptus globulus leaf oil - is soothing and highly therapeutic. The sharp, fresh and herbaceous aroma is commonly used for aromatherapy. It has wide-ranging health benefits including decongestant, anti-inflammatory, antispasmodic, antiseptic, antifungal, antimicrobial, antiviral, and antibacterial properties.

eugenia caryophyllus (clove) bud oil - this essential oil smells just like clove spice and has a warming sensation when applied topically on skin, and is helpful in aromatherapy blends intended to help relieve pain.

fuller’s earth clay (aka multanni mitti) - this clay cleanses and purifies skin by pulling out dirt, oil and impurities. Recommended for oily skin.

fusanus spicatus wood oil - Australian sandalwood oil has a soft, sweet, rich, woody aroma and helps to promote a healthy even skin tone.

gaultheria procumbens (wintergreen) leaf oil - a minty, sweet, woody scent that is uplifting and stimulating when used in aromatherapy.

glycerin (Ecocert) - is a humectant that attracts moisture in the air to the skin, and with emollient properties that soften and smooth skin. 

glyceryl caprylate - a 100% plant derived, natural (Ecocert approved) multi-functional ingredient that has emollient and moisturizing properties, and is a co-emulsifier that can be used to stabilize oil in water emulsions.

glycine soja (soybean) oil - is a very light carrier oil high in lecithin, sterolins and vitamin E. It is safe to use and can provide protection from mosquitoes when applied to the skin.

hamamelis virginiana (witch hazel) water - alcohol free witch hazel distillate that provides soothing, astringent properties when caring for the skin.

helianthus annus (sunflower) seed oil - a wonderful skin conditioning carrier oil high in vitamins A, B, D, E and minerals and containing beneficial amounts of lecithin and unsaturated fatty acids.

helichrysum italicum flower water - has a warm, herbaceous tea-like aroma, that helps stimulate collagen production and reduce the appearance of fine lines and wrinkles.

himalayan pink salt - also known as Himalayan Rock Salt, this salt is hand-mined and harvested from ancient salt beds, deep under the Himalayan Mountains. Known to be rich in over 80 minerals and trace elements, some of the most notable being calcium, magnesium, potassium, copper, and iron, this salt is considered to be the purest form of salt available. Use in your bath to promote relaxation and soothe irritated skin conditions.

hydrastis canadensis (goldenseal) root - is a natural anti-inflammatory, antiseptic and healing herb. Goldenseal’s skin healing properties are thanks to phytochemical alkaloids: berberine, canadine and hydrastine that produce a powerful ‘astringent effect’ on mucous membranes, which means it has a calming and healing effect on the skin. A rich source of Vitamin A, B, C and E, it also contains important minerals: iron, zinc, potassium, calcium, and manganese

Illite (french clay green) - absorbs and removes impurities from the skin, revealing the fresh surface to provide a healthy looking glow. Rich in magnesium, calcium, potassium, silicon, selenium, aluminum, titanium, cobalt, sodium, phosphorus, copper and zinc it acts as a magnet, drawing out impurities and leaving your skin clear, smooth and hydrated. Recommended for normal / combination skin.

Illite/kaolin (french clay pink) - gently exfoliates dead skin cells, clean pores, brightens your complexion, and helps increase cell turnover, leaving the skin smooth and radiant. Recommended for normal / mature / sensitive skin.

juniperus communis (juniper berry) fruit oil - has a medium aroma with a woody, mildly camphoraceous scent, with a calming and grounding effect.

kaolin clay - smooths, exfoliates and detoxifies skin, absorbs excess oils and fights acne; it can strengthen and improve skin health and brighten your complexion. Recommended for combination / oily skin.

lactobacillus ferment - a probiotic ingredient that is helpful in killing harmful bacteria and creating a healthy balanced microflora. It also can serve in a formula as part of a natural preservative system.

lactobacillus & cocos nucifera (coconut) fruit extract - a fermentation that offers probiotics, non-irritating moisturization, and a natural solution to synthetic preservatives.

lavandula angustifolium (lavender) buds - dried from lavender flowers, providing a sweet floral scent and promoting a calm relaxed mood. We use lavender buds in our facial steams and botanical bath teas. 

lavandula officinalis (lavender) flower oil / water - a rich, sweet and floral lavender aroma promotes feelings of relaxation and calm. Anti-inflammatory properties make it great for soothing and healing skin that's irritated or reddened from the sun, insect bites, or bacteria.

limmanthes alba (meadowfoam) seed oil - contains 98% fatty acids with wonderful moisturizing and rejuvenating properties. Absorbs easily into the skin leaving a silky smooth feel.

linum usitatissium (flax) seed oil - an emollient, high in essential fatty acids, vitamin E , vitamin B and minerals. It contains the alpha-linoleic acids (ALAs) which may contribute to younger looking skin. Flax Seed Oil is reputed to be  excellent oil to use on sensitive skin as it is very soothing and reputed reduce the appearance of cellulite and to improve elasticity in skin. 

maris sal (dead sea) salt - is the most saline body of water in the world with far greater concentrations of minerals than any ocean (a concentration of 32% minerals compared to other seas). Bromides and Iodine are known to be present, along with other minerals in a dried form, such as Magnesium, Sodium, Calcium and Potassium. All these minerals are believed to work together to assist in relaxing and soothing the body to provide a sense of well being.

matricaria recutita (chamomile) botanical extract - is a fine powder that is brownish yellow in colour and is extracted using water. It is commonly known for its its soothing properties and is used in topical applications.

melaleuca alternifolia (tea tree) leaf oil - has a fresh, slightly medicinal scent with characteristic woody, camphoraceous notes. It has been used for decades, and medical studies have documented its advantages as a beneficial aid in eliminating bacteria, viruses, and fungi. 

melaleuca leucadendron (cajeput) leaf oil - has a fresh, camphorous aroma with a slight fruity note; has antimicrobial properties and is an active agent that fights against and prevents infections, bacteria, and viruses while regenerating damaged skin

mentha piperita (peppermint) oil - has a sharp, penetrating scent based on its high menthol content. The minty sweetness of the vapour makes it a popular essential oil. When applied topically it helps relieve headaches, muscle aches, joint pain, and itching.

mentha spicata (spearmint) herb oil - is a top note with a medium aroma and has a characteristic scent that is sweeter than the minty aroma of peppermint. It is multi-purpose and provides soothing properties when applied topically to skin.

menthol - these colorless, transparent crystals, made by crystallizing peppermint oil, exude a sharp, minty scent, which has a cooling effect that makes them ideal for addressing aches, pain, cramps, sprains, and irritation. 

moroccan lava clay - rhassoul - sourced from the fertile Atlas Mountains of Morocco, it is rich in silica, potassium, magnesium and calcium, giving it  impressive properties that benefit the skin in its capacity to absorb. 

myroxylon pereirae (balsam peru) oil - has a mild but deep, rich aroma that is woody yet sweet with a vanilla and benzoin quality, and has been used over the years to help remedy a number of skin issues including dry skin, and minor cuts and wounds.

natural butterscotch flavour oil - is made from all natural flavour constituents and has a rich, buttery scent.

natural cherry flavour oil - is made from all natural flavour constituents and has a ripe, juicy and succulent scent.

natural chocolate flavour oil - is made from all natural flavour constituents and has a sweet yummy chocolate scent.

natural coconut flavour oil - is made from all natural flavour constituents and has a tropical rich and creamy coconut scent.

natural french vanilla flavour oil - is made from all natural flavour constituents and has a delicious sweet and creamy vanilla scent.

natural raspberry flavour oil - is made from all natural flavour constituents and has a hearty fresh scent of ripe raspberry.

natural strawberry flavour oil - is made from all natural flavour constituents and has a sweet and succulent fresh strawberry scent.

nepeta cataria (catnip) oil - the aroma is basically green and herbaceous with sweet floral hints and can be used to deter mosquitos, flies, fleas and ticks.

non nano zinc oxide - is a white, powdery mineral with a sun protection benefits. It’s one of the main active ingredients found in mineral sunscreen. Rather than soaking into the skin, zinc actually sits on top of your skin and protects by scattering and reflecting the sun’s rays.

oenothera biennis (evening primrose) oil - is a rich source of gamma linoleic acid, omega 3 and omega 6 fatty acids which provide a nourishment to the skin and is reputed to soothe and relieve the skin while reducing the appearance of fine lines and wrinkles.

origanum majorana (marjoram) flower oil - has a woody and spicy aroma that has a warming calming effect. 

oryza sativa (rice) bran oil - is extracted from the bran or outer coat of the brown rice grain removed during the milling process. It is rich in vitamins, minerals, proteins and essential oils.

panthenol pelargonium roseum (rose geranium) leaf oil - the scent is typical of geranium but with a rosy note. It benefits skin by tightening, brightening, balancing and promotes healthly cell renewal, reducing the appearance of dull skin.

piper nigrum (black pepper) fruit oil - has a sharp, spicy scent with warming properties that can help relieve pain from tired or injured muscles.

plantago major (plantain) - a herb renowned for its wound healing properties, containing allantoin - a skin soothing agent that promotes cell growth, which also has great drawing ability and can be used in the treatment of insect bites and stings. 

pogostemon cablin (patchouli dark) leaf oil - has an enticing earthy aroma and boasts calming and grounding properties often used to improve mood.

potassium citrate - is a salt form of citric acid and can be used as a chelating agent (binds with metal ions increasing the stability and efficacy of products) or to adjust the ph of a finished product.

potassium cocoate (coconut oil) - is a potassium salt of fatty acids derived from the saponification of coconut oil during the soap making process.

potassium oleate (sunflower oil) - is a potassium salt of oleic acid and is a fatty acid used as an emulsifying agent and cleansing agent.

prunus armeniaca (apricot) ground shells - ground from the seeds of apricots, this all natural exfoliant is perfect for deep-cleaning, renewing and detoxifying all skin types.

prunus dulcis (sweet almond) oil - is an excellent emollient and is known for its ability to soften and condition the skin. Extracted by cold-pressing the roasted seed kernels of the Almond tree, this oil consists of mostly oleic and linoleic triglycerides and imparts beneficial properties when used in cosmetic applications.

pumice powder super fine - light grey porous volcanic floating rocks, ground into a fine powder, and is an excellent exfoliant for use in creams, lotions and scrubs.

rosa canine (rosehip) extra virgin oil - This oil is of the highest quality, and Extra Virgin means that it was produced from the first pressing of the seeds. It has a high content of Vitamin E and essential fatty acids, containing 77% linoleic acid (Omega 6) and a-linolenic acid (Omega 3). High in antioxidants, it helps reduce the appearance of fine lines and wrinkles, improves pigmentation and moisturizes skin.

rosewood (natural blend) essential oil - natural blends are oils obtained by blending natural isolates from various essential oils to achieve an economical product that resembles the fragrance of the pure essential oil. Natural Blends are all natural, and do not contain any synthetic ingredients or aromatic compounds, nor do they contain artificial flavours or colorants. Rosewood is now an endangered species, so this is a substitute blend made up of purely natural constituents to smell as much like the real Rosewood as possible.

rosmarinus officinalis (rosemary) leaf oil - has a fresh, strong, woody and herbal scent. It can be used to soothe sore muscles, improve skin tone and texture, and reduce acne and other skin irritations.

salix alba L (white willow bark) botanical extract - the use of Willow dates back 6000 years. Ancient civilizations used White Willow Bark Extract for conditions associated with pain and inflammation. It is a popular ingredient in skin care formulations where it is used to assist in managing the oiliness of the skin. It can be used as an exfoliant and as an astringent. White Willow Bark Extract is also believed to be an effective purifying agent and is used in preparations for tinctures, balms, soap, facial cleansers, creams, and lotions. 

salvia officinalis (sage) oil - has a herbaceous scent with strong musty notes and has been reputed to support, balance, comfort and soothe the body, mind and spirit.

salvia sclaria (clary sage) oil - has a herbaceous with a sweet, floral aroma and when applied topically, calms and soothes the skin.

simmondsia chinensis (jojoba) oil - (pronounced ho-ho-ba) it is rich in Vitamin E, Vitamin B Complex, and a broad spectrum of fatty acids. Although it is considered an oil, Jojoba oil’s texture is more like that of liquid wax. It closely resembles the sebum of the skin, which promotes a glowing complexion when applied topically.

sodium anisate - is a 100% natural preservative obtained from anise and fennel. It’s an antimicrobial agent, one that helps to preserve products and prevents germs and bacteria from building up.

sodium bicarbonate - (aka baking soda) is used in cosmetics for its abrasive properties and anti-bacterial properties.

sodium castorate (castor) oilis a Sodium salt of the fatty acids derived from the saponification of castor oil and is used in soap making.

sodium cocoate (coconut) oil - is the sodium salt of the fatty acids of coconut oil. It is derived from the saponification of coconut oil and is used in soap making.

sodium cocoyl glutamate - is a mild vegetable-based surfactant (foaming ingredient) derived from coconut or palm kernel oil and glucose from corn.

sodium benzoate (and) potassium sorbate - a liquid cosmetic preservative, which can be used in leave-on as well as in rinse-off products. Used at low levels, the combination of these ingredients provide the full spectrum protection needed to ensure a product does not become contaminated.

sodium hyaluronate - an all-natural water-soluble form of Hyaluronic Acid. Hyaluronic Acid is a polysaccharide that occurs naturally in the human body and works to support the body’s collagen production and to help maintain elasticity. The added gain when using Sodium Hyaluronate is that it penetrates the skin more easily than Hyaluronic Acid. In the skin, it works to occupy the areas between collagen and elastin and renew and enhance the skin’s natural suppleness for a healthy appearance and texture.

sodium lactateis the natural sodium salt of lactic acid derived from the fermentation of sugar. In skin care, this ingredient is used primarily as a hydrating and buffering agent (to adjust a product’s pH value).

sodium levulinateis the sodium salt of levulinic acid, and is used as a preservative and skin conditioning agent in cosmetics and personal care products. It is gentle and proven to be able to control microorganism colonies without altering the integrity, colour or pH of other ingredients included in the final product.

sodium palmate (palm) oilis the sodium salt of the fatty acids of palm oil. It is derived from the saponification of coconut oil and is used in soap making.

sodium phytate - is the sodium salt of phytic acid. It is generally used to help stabalize products but has secondary benefits as well; it can moisturize, improve skin elasticity, and balance oily skin. It is an all-natural chelating agent that can be used as a replacement for disodium and tetrasodium EDTA in cosmetic products.

stelloria media (chickweed) herb -  is an astringent herb that has soothing, cooling, hydrating and healing properties when applied to sensitive or dry skin.

styrax benzoin resin oil - has a sweet, warm and vanilla-like aroma and contains a range of chemical compounds that contributes to the oil's scent and healing properties.

sucrose (sugar)is the generic name for sweet-tasting, soluble carbohydrates. We use brown sugar in our body scrubs.

theobroma cacao (cocoa) seed butter - is a natural, cream colored vegetable fat extracted from cocoa beans during the process of separating the powder and liquor from the bean. Cocoa Butter generally has a soft, sweet cocoa aroma and it is one of the most stable fats known. It is excellent to moisturize skin and keep it soft smooth and supple.

tocopherol (vitamin e) - is a golden yellow to reddish, viscous oil having a slight characteristic vegetable oil aroma. Studies have shown that Vitamin E plays a crucial role in protecting the skin from environmental factors. The d-alpha-tocopherol in Vitamin E is also known to helps reduce the appearance of fine lines. It is a natural antioxidant with a full spectrum of tocopherols, which will extend the shelf-life of other oils and anhydrous (without water) products.

vetiveria zizanoides (vetiver) root oil - has a strong, earthy, woody scent characteristic of oils derived from roots. Used in aromatherapy applications, Vetiver Essential Oil is beneficial for soothing anxiety, insomnia, fatigue, depression, and inability to concentrate or remember. Used cosmetically or topically in general, Vetiver Essential Oil is known to firm, tighten, and protect skin against the harsh effects of environmental stressors,

vitis vinifera (grape) seed oil - this oil is obtained from the seeds of grapes cultivated in South Africa. The oil is obtained by cold pressing the seeds. Grapeseed oil is an important source of antioxidants and nutrients and it helps to protect the skin against the abuse of environmental elements. The high contents of omega 6 fatty acids are known to nourish and improve the texture of skin. It is light and dry and absorbs easily, with properties that help protect the skin's moisture barrier and relieve itching due to dry skin. With a high content of linoleic acid the oil provides moisturizing benefits and prevents water loss.
